## Deployment

The Quillbarrow gateway places a bloom filter in front of the Hexvault key-value store to reject lookups for keys that provably do not exist. This reduces read amplification and limits probe-based enumeration attempts. The filter is rebuilt on each deploy from a snapshot of the keyspace. For review purposes, the deployed filter and store settings are listed below.

settings of fawip-yadug:
[druath]
port = 3000
region = north-4
host = druath.qirvanworks.corp
timeout_ms = 1500
retries = 1

CI note: digest scheduler flaked on Mellowpost staging again. Cron fires at :05 but the batch email digest job races the template cache warmup. Fix: pin warmup before scheduler start in the pipeline, not after. Don't bump the retry count — it masks the race. Verified green on three consecutive runs. The passing run's token is recorded below.

session token of tajef-bageg = htk21_5d90d574934f3ccae6437

14:22 — Log volume from the Pingwell notifier spiked 40x after the Quillback release. Ingest costs climbed; support dashboards lagged by minutes. On-call enabled 1:50 sampling on debug-level lines only; errors and warnings remain unsampled. Dashboards recovered by 14:41. If a customer reports missing log lines from this window, that's expected. Verified fixes shipped in the hotfix noted below.

build token for yajof-bajof: htk31_506ff1188f74596b5bb2eec94edc43c

Subject: Loan pieces back to the Calveston gallery

Hi dispatch,

The three exhibition pieces on loan from the Calveston gallery are crated and waiting in bay two. They need to go back Friday — insurance coverage lapses over the weekend, so no slipping to Monday, please. Book Hartwell Fine Transit, padded van only, and flag it as fragile art.

One thing for the driver at hand-over:

handover note for yagef-bagep: the drudor pelius courier leaves the kasdor zorvan norir ledger at gate 8016 under passcode 755406